About The Company

Jeeny is a leading ride-hailing platform that strives to revolutionize daily commuting and transportation. Our app connects users with their preferred modes of transportation, making mobility accessible, convenient, and affordable for all.

We are a joint venture between MEIG (Middle East Internet Group), Rocket Internet, and IMENA. Since our inception, we have grown exponentially and currently operate in Saudi Arabia and Jordan.

Job Brief

We are looking for a driven and commercially minded Partnerships Associate to support the development and execution of strategic partnerships that contribute to Jeeny's growth and market expansion.

This role will focus on building and maintaining a strong pipeline of potential partners across key sectors such as banking, telecommunications, aviation, tourism, corporate mobility, and public transportation
. The successful candidate will work on identifying partnership opportunities, structuring collaborations, and converting them into active initiatives that generate measurable business impact.

The Partnerships Associate will collaborate closely with internal teams including marketing, product, operations, finance, and legal to ensure partnerships are successfully launched, managed, and optimized.

Key Responsibilities
  • Identify, develop, and manage strategic partnership opportunities that support business growth, ride demand, and market expansion.
  • Build and maintain a strong pipeline of potential partners across sectors such as banking, telecommunications, aviation, tourism, public transportation, and corporate mobility.
  • Evaluate partnership opportunities from both commercial and strategic perspectives, ensuring alignment with company objectives and long-term growth priorities.
  • Structure, negotiate, and execute partnership agreements, integrations, and joint initiatives with external partners.
  • Manage the end-to-end partnership lifecycle, including prospecting, lead generation, negotiation, activation, and performance monitoring.
  • Develop commercial frameworks and partnership plans that enable scalable collaborations and measurable business outcomes.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ams including marketing, product, operations, finance, and legal to ensure successful partnership implementation.
  • Track and report on partnership performance metrics such as ride generation, revenue contribution, user acquisition, and campaign performance.
  • Maintain strong and professional relationships with partner organizations and key stakeholders to ensure effective collaboration.
  • Manage multiple partnership opportunities simultaneously while maintaining a high level of professionalism, organization, and operational discipline.
  • Identify opportunities for innovation and ecosystem expansion within the mobility and transportation landscape.
